X revoked API access for InfoFi apps like Kaito and Cookie DAO after their mechanisms flooded CT with low-effort AI spam. Kaito shut down Yaps, Cookie sunset Snaps, and both tokens dumped hard as leaderboards froze. Users celebrated cleaner timelines, while builders scrambled for alternatives.
After being “mocked” by Solana for low base-layer activity, Starknet launched STRK directly on Solana using NEAR Intents, enabling seamless swaps via Jupiter and Meteora. The move highlighted Starknet’s real DeFi traction while turning the roast into a cross-ecosystem win.
Saturn raised $800K to launch USDat, a Bitcoin-adjacent stablecoin offering ~11% yield backed by Strategy’s STRC preferred shares and U.S. Treasuries. The pitch: a transparent, monthly-paying yield that bridges institutional credit into DeFi, although returns are variable and not guaranteed.
Bitmine Immersion Technologies announced a $200M equity investment in MrBeast’s Beast Industries, betting its massive Gen Z reach can accelerate crypto’s mainstream adoption. Shareholders are split on whether this is visionary distribution or a distraction from the ETH-native focus.

Zebec Network integrated World Liberty Financial’s USD1 stablecoin into its payroll and card rails, fueling comparisons to XRP’s early infrastructure thesis. Unlike XRP’s slow grind, ZBCN already has live payroll, cards, and compliant stablecoin flows, compressing years of adoption into months.
Pudgy Penguins announced a premium collectible and merch collaboration with Manchester City, bringing Pengu to a global football audience. The drop goes live January 17, marking another mainstream brand crossover for NFTs.
Ripple partnered with LMAX to integrate its RLUSD stablecoin as core collateral across spot, FX, perps, and CFDs. Backed by $150M in Ripple financing, the deal pushes stablecoins deeper into institutional trading infrastructure.

MilkyWay Protocol announced a permanent shutdown after failing to find sustainable DeFi demand. A final snapshot distributed accrued USDC fees to holders, and the remaining team tokens will be burned. A rare, clean exit in DeFi.
pumpdotfun launched Callouts, letting users send push notifications to followers recommending a coin every six hours. With global leaderboards ranking calls by performance, influencer-driven price discovery just got a native mobile weapon.
